Begin by preheating your oven to 400°F (200°C). Prepare a baking sheet by lining it with parchment paper to prevent sticking.
Carefully open the can of refrigerated pizza dough and transfer it onto a lightly floured workspace. Gently stretch the dough to ensure it’s flat and manageable.
Using a sharp knife or pizza cutter, slice the dough into strips approximately 1 inch wide and 6 inches long, making sure the strips are even for uniform baking.
Take each strip and shape it into a knot by twisting it and tucking the ends underneath. Alternatively, you can twist the strips for a playful look. Place each finished knot onto the prepared baking sheet.
In a separate small bowl, combine the melted butter with the minced garlic, grated Parmesan cheese, chopped parsley, dried oregano, and a pinch of salt. For those who enjoy a bit of heat, sprinkle in the crushed red pepper flakes. Mix thoroughly until well blended.
Using a pastry brush, generously apply the garlic butter mixture to each knot, ensuring they are coated evenly for maximum flavor.
Place the baking sheet in the oven and bake the knots for 12-15 minutes, or until they puff up and achieve a glorious golden-brown hue.
As soon as the knots are out of the oven, brush them with any remaining garlic butter mixture for an extra burst of flavor.
Allow the knots to cool for a few minutes on the baking sheet before transferring them to a serving platter.
